WebThe Select Board is composed of five members who are elected for overlapping three-year terms. As specified in the Reading Home Rule Charter they are the Chief Elected Officers of the Town. The Select Board appoints a Town Manager who is responsible for the daily management of the Town, whose powers are specified in the Reading Home Rule Charter. WebAccording to the Reading Home Rule Charter: Section 4-1: Board of Assessors. There shall be a Board of Assessors consisting of three members appointed for three year terms so arranged that one term shall expire each year. The Board of Assessors may appoint property appraisers and shall have all the powers and duties given to Boards of Assessors ... WebJul 24, 2014 · The commission’s job is to assess the current government and make a recommendation. If home rule is recommended, the commission writes a home rule charter. The charter is adopted—and home rule is established—by a majority vote in a referendum. Any changes to the charter must be put up for a vote. WebMar 27, 2024 · Reading, PA Code of Ordinances READING, PA CODE OF ORDINANCES READING, PA CODE OF ORDINANCES Current through March 13, 2024 Published by: … WebUnder the Home Rule Charter, the City of Reading is divided into six districts, with each district electing one Council member. District-elected Council members represent the voice of their District and act as a body to make decisions in the best interest of the entire City. The President of Council is elected at-large as the presiding officer ...

WebIn the United States, home rule is an authority of a constituent part of a U.S. state to exercise powers of governance delegated to it by its state government. In some states, known as home rule states, the state's constitution grants municipalities and/or counties the ability to pass laws to govern themselves as they see fit (so long as they ...
